Transaction 04c16056733e2bb27c987acee4a7d2d514d0f326440192d9b2e633e07ec5ac73

1 Input
2 Outputs
  • 04c16056733e2bb27c987acee4a7d2d514d0f326440192d9b2e633e07ec5ac73:0
  • value  1329162
    address  3F8h1Yqq4yRcQaKvzTzZ9KRrdF82RCtcHk
  • 04c16056733e2bb27c987acee4a7d2d514d0f326440192d9b2e633e07ec5ac73:1
  • value  26827709
    address  bc1qya6tch3vndr3mjjhla36xd79jam28kzfvclwdd